Can running 100km change your Eye's blood vessels?

NCT ID NCT07748936

First seen Aug 06, 2026 · Last updated Aug 07, 2026 · Updated 1 time

Summary

This pilot study looks at whether running an ultra-trail race—a very long, intense endurance event—causes temporary changes in the tiny blood vessels at the back of the eye. Researchers will use a non-invasive imaging technique called OCT angiography to measure blood flow in the retina and choroid of ultra-trail runners before and shortly after the race. They will compare these measurements to a control group of active people who do not run the race. The goal is to understand how extreme physical exertion affects eye circulation and whether retinal imaging could serve as a window into overall cardiovascular health.

What this could lead to
If this works, it could show that simple eye scans can reveal how extreme exercise stresses the body's blood vessels, potentially aiding cardiovascular research and prevention.
What could go wrong
This is a small pilot study, so results may not apply broadly. Changes in eye blood flow after a race might be temporary and not reflect long-term health.
